Corporate Headquarters
The main office or central hub of a corporation where key managerial and executive activities occur, often seen as the symbolic and functional center of the company.
Board of Directors
A group of individuals elected by shareholders to oversee the activities and direction of a company.
Campaign Contributions
Financial donations given to political candidates, parties, or campaigns to support their activities and efforts towards election.
Superfund
A federal government program designed to fund the cleanup of sites contaminated with hazardous substances and pollutants.
